Orthopaedic Research UK are a British charity who raise funding for bone and joint problems. The informational film, produced by ‘Inspired Films’ describes ORUKs charitable contributions and their research. Using pictogram style elements and flat graphics, we managed to create a film that holds a lot of informative text, but which is still enjoyable to view.

The Real Mr & Mrs Assad – Dispatches
The ‘Dispatches’ team, led by reporter Jonathon Miller, investigated the glamourous, Western looking Assads and plotted their connections to the atrocities on the ground in Syria. The graphics were integral to the narrative of the programme, as they displayed the web of connections to President Assad and his extended family. Two large scale canvases were built incorporating militaristic detailing and gritty textures and then animated hand-drawn circles and lines highlighted the individuals concerned. The jump cutting and rapid tracking into detail further enhanced this forensic looking environment.

Renaissance Revolution
The new Blakeway TV BBC Arts series presented by Matthew Collings, transmits Saturdays on BBC2 at 8pm. The first is on 16th October 2010, which features Raphael’s ‘Madonna of the Meadow’, followed by Bosch’s ‘Garden of Earthly delights’ and lastly Piero’s ‘Baptism of Christ’
